How do Ukrainians see their path to peace? | BBC News


European Union leaders are in Kyiv and have joined President Voldymyr Zelensky on the third anniversary of Russia’s full-scale invasion of Ukraine.

Zelensky is trying to rally allies after the souring of relations with President Donald Trump, who falsely claimed Kyiv started the war.

Ukraine’s president posted on social media hailing his country’s "resistance" and "heroism".

Over the weekend, Russia launched its largest drone attack yet, targeting at least 13 regions, including the capital Kyiv.

BBC Correspondent James Waterhouse has spoken to Ukrainians about how they see their path to peace.
